This setting changes the temperature range (upper limit and lower
Heating
limit) which is set from the remote controller or central control device.
The set upper limit must be greater than or equal to the lower limit.
Drying
If the temperature setting is to be a single point, set the upper limit
and lower limit to the same temperature.

This setting switches the filter input according to the purpose of use.
This setting indicates whether or not an indoor unit electronic control
valve is present.
At the time of shipping, this setting is set according to the conditions
of the indoor unit.
Ordinarily, the T10 terminal is used as the HA terminal at the time
of shipping. However, this setting is used when the T10 terminal is
used for OFF reminder or for fire prevention input.
It is possible to install a ventilation fan in the system, which can be
started and stopped by the wired remote controller. The ventilation
fan can operate linked with the start and stop of the indoor unit, or
can be operated even when the indoor unit is stopped.
Use a ventilation fan that can accept the no-voltage A contact as the
external input signal.
In the case of group control, the fans are operated together. They
cannot be operated individually.
This setting is used to switch from the body sensor to the remote
controller sensor.
Check that "remote controller sensor" is displayed.
Do not use this setting with models that do not include a remote
controller sensor.
Do not use this setting if both the body sensor and remote sensor
are used.
In a MULTI system with multiple remote controllers, switching
between heating and cooling is restricted, and "Operation change
control in progress" is displayed.
This setting is used to prevent this display from appearing.
Refer to the item concerned with operating mode priorities.
This setting switches the operation when the weekly timer is
connected to the remote controller.
This can be used to prevent cases in which the unit is accidentally
left ON. There is no change when this setting is ON, however it is
necessary to set the weekly timer ON time.
